The Internet is a way of life for US college students. A recent survey by Harris Interactive and 360 youth found that 93 per cent of American college students visit the Internet, and this market is expected to grow from 15.2 million in 2003 to 16.4 million in 2007.
That is slow but it could be the result of the already high number of Internet college users. About 88 per cent of American college students own a computer, and more than half have broadband (宽带) connections. Furthermore, 67 per cent own cell phones and 36 per cent use their mobile devices to visit the Internet.
Study findings show that 42 per cent go online mainly to communicate socially, and 72 percent of college students check emails at least once a day, with 66 per cent using at least two email addresses. The most popular online social activity is sending messages to friends or family, with 37 percent of college students saying they do so.
The study also looked beyond the Internet surfing habits and into the buying habits of this group, and found them responsible for more than $ 210 billion in sales last year alone. College students have learned how to spend their money, with 93 per cent saying low prices are important when shopping.
The study also shows that 65 per cent make loan (贷款) payments; 41 per cent of freshmen have a credit card; and 79 per cent of seniors have a credit card. A great number of charges on those credit cards are likely to be for entertainment and leisure expenses.
